Quando i valori vengono importati o copiati in un foglio di lavoro Excel, i valori possono essere visualizzati come testo anziché come dati numerici. Questa situazione causa problemi se i dati sono ordinati o se i dati vengono utilizzati nei calcoli che coinvolgono le funzioni incorporate di Excel.
Le informazioni contenute in questo articolo si applicano a Excel 2019, Excel 2016, Excel 2013, Excel 2010, Excel 2019 per Mac, Excel 2016 per Mac e Excel per Mac 2011.
Converti dati importati da testo in formato numerico
Nell'immagine sopra, la funzione SOMMA è impostata per sommare i tre valori (23, 45 e 78) situati nelle celle da D1 a D3.
Invece di restituire 146 come risposta, la funzione restituisce uno zero perché i tre valori sono stati immessi come testo anziché come dati numerici.
Indizi del foglio di lavoro
La formattazione predefinita di Excel per diversi tipi di dati è spesso un indizio che i dati vengono importati o inseriti in modo errato. Per impostazione predefinita, i dati numerici, così come i risultati di formula e funzione, sono allineati sul lato destro di una cella, mentre i valori di testo sono allineati a sinistra.
I numeri 23, 45 e 78 nell'immagine sopra sono allineati sul lato sinistro delle celle perché sono valori di testo. Il risultato della funzione SUM nella cella D4 è allineato a destra.
Inoltre, Excel indica potenziali problemi con il contenuto di una cella visualizzando un piccolo triangolo verde nell'angolo in alto a sinistra della cella. In questo caso, il triangolo verde indica che i valori nelle celle da D1 a D3 sono formattati come testo.
Continua a leggere sotto
Risolvi i dati problema con Incolla speciale
Per modificare questi dati in formato numerico, utilizzare la funzione VALUE in Excel e Incolla speciale.
Incolla speciale è una versione estesa del comando incolla che fornisce una serie di opzioni relative a ciò che viene trasferito tra le celle durante un'operazione di copia / incolla. Queste opzioni includono operazioni matematiche di base come addizione e moltiplicazione.
Continua a leggere sotto
Moltiplicare i valori per 1 con Incolla speciale
L'opzione di moltiplicazione in Incolla speciale moltiplica tutti i numeri di una certa quantità e incolla la risposta nella cella di destinazione. Converte anche i valori di testo in numeri quando ogni voce viene moltiplicata per un valore di 1.
L'esempio, mostrato nell'immagine sottostante, fa uso di questa funzione Incolla speciale. Questi sono i risultati dell'operazione:
- La risposta alla funzione SOMMA cambia da zero a 146.
- I tre valori cambiano l'allineamento dal lato sinistro della cella a destra.
- Gli indicatori di errore del triangolo verde vengono rimossi dalle celle contenenti i dati.
Preparare il foglio di lavoro
Per convertire i valori di testo in numeri di dati, inserisci prima alcuni numeri come testo. Questo viene fatto digitando un apostrofo ( ' ) davanti a ciascun numero quando viene inserito in una cella.
- Apri un nuovo foglio di lavoro in Excel.
- Seleziona cella D1 per renderlo la cella attiva.
- Digita un apostrofo seguito dal numero 23 nella cella ('23).
- stampa Accedere. Come mostrato nell'immagine sopra, la cella D1 ha un triangolo verde nell'angolo in alto a sinistra della cella e il numero 23 è allineato sul lato destro. L'apostrofo non è visibile nella cella.
- Seleziona cella D2.
- Digita un apostrofo seguito dal numero 45 nella cella ('45).
- stampa Accedere.
- Seleziona cella D3.
- Digita un apostrofo seguito dal numero 78 nella cella ('78).
- stampa Accedere.
- Seleziona cella E1.
- Digita il numero 1 (nessun apostrofo) nella cella e premere accedere.
Il numero 1 è allineato sul lato destro della cella, come mostrato nell'immagine sopra.
Per visualizzare l'apostrofo davanti ai numeri immessi nelle celle da D1 a D3, selezionare una di queste celle, ad esempio D3. Nella barra della formula sopra il foglio di lavoro, la voce '78 è visibile.
Continua a leggere sotto
Immettere la funzione SUM
- Seleziona cella D4.
- genere = SUM (D1: D3).
- stampa accedere.
- La risposta 0 appare nella cella D4 perché i valori nelle celle da D1 a D3 sono stati immessi come testo.
Oltre alla digitazione, altri metodi per immettere la funzione SUM in una cella del foglio di lavoro includono:
- Tasti di scelta rapida
- Finestra di dialogo della funzione SUM
- Somma automatica
Converti testo in numeri con Incolla speciale
- Seleziona cella E1 per renderlo la cella attiva.
- Selezionare Casa > copia. Una linea tratteggiata appare intorno alla cella E1 che indica che il contenuto di questa cella viene copiato negli Appunti.
- Evidenzia celle Da D1 a D3.
- Seleziona il Incolla freccia giù per aprire il menu a discesa.
- Selezionare Incolla speciale per aprire la finestra di dialogo Incolla speciale.
- Nella sezione Operazione, selezionare Moltiplicare per attivare questa operazione.
- Selezionare ok per chiudere la finestra di dialogo e tornare al foglio di lavoro.
Continua a leggere sotto
Risultati del foglio di lavoro
Come mostrato nell'immagine sopra, ecco come i risultati di questa operazione cambiano il foglio di lavoro:
- I tre valori nelle celle da D1 a D3 sono allineati a destra in ogni cella.
- I triangoli verdi sono spariti dall'angolo in alto a destra di ogni cella.
- Il risultato per la funzione SOMMA nella cella D4 è 146, che è il totale per i tre numeri nelle celle da D1 a D3.